Output 383ba65f42f1b51c4f9e4f7ae0f6b51ff2d3a2a333ce62b04667774c4e080fcd:1

value
6836437
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d57bf5ba917957a8f84555fcb94fc8624c002d5 OP_EQUAL
address
3MsNNjvkDLBftt5pUqcozDms8TCyXmiGqW
transaction
383ba65f42f1b51c4f9e4f7ae0f6b51ff2d3a2a333ce62b04667774c4e080fcd
confirmations
531236
spent
true